Cranbourne sizzle

David Burnett has Snags McKenzie engaged in the $50,000-to-the-winner Group 2 Backmans Greyhound Supplies Cranbourne Cup final (520m) on Saturday night.

“He’s due to ‘snag’ a group race soon,” Burnett quipped, in reference to four previous attempts at ‘black type’ honours.

“He’s 100 per cent ready, but the wide draw (Box 6) is probably not ideal,” Burnett said. “He’ll need a bit of room early, but if he runs up to his recent 29.29sec win at Sandown he’ll be very competitive.”

Bred, owned and trained by Burnett, Snags McKenzie (Nov ’16 Magic Sprite x Boston Silver) has raced on 52 occasions for 16 wins, seven seconds and 10 thirds, with $89,670 in prize money.

He’s been a finalist in the G1 Gold Bullion, G2 Ballarat Cup, G3 Cup Night Sprint (2nd to Simon Told Helen) and G3 Golden Ticket. He also made last year’s G2 Geelong Gold Cup final but was scratched after pulling off a toenail on the way to the track.
